3. Continuous / undated

Driver Mechanics Quantified
Federal Reserve policy Float revenue is interest earned on ~$3,999m of funds held for customers. Realised yield ~3.7% TTM. ~$40m of revenue per 100bp, ≈ 2.5% of total revenue. Float is already −10.0% year-over-year and −6.6% in the latest quarter.
Take-rate progression Transaction fees ÷ TPV: 28.2bp (Dec-23) → 33.3bp (Mar-26). The entire growth mechanism. Reported every quarter; derivable from the release.
Buyback execution $272.7m repurchased in 9M FY2026; ~1.0m shares for ~$52m in Q3 FY26 alone. $1.0bn authorised. Visible in each 10-Q cash flow statement.
Customer count 498,500 (Dec-25) → 493,800 (Mar-26), first sequential decline in eight quarters. Reported every quarter in the release.
Divvy credit quality Acquired card receivables $819.4m, allowance $18.3m (2.2%); provision $18.8m in Q3 FY26, +26% YoY. Balance sheet and income statement each quarter.

5. The one date that matters

Late August 2026. The Q4/FY2026 print carries, in a single document:

  1. FY2027 guidance — the test of whether core growth holds ≥13% (the base case) or breaks below 12% (the invalidation).
  2. Net dollar-based retention for FY2026 — 94% or lower ends the thesis.
  3. Businesses using our solutions at 30 June 2026 — a second consecutive sequential decline halves the position.
  4. The FY2026 take rate — FY2024 29.6bp, FY2025 31.2bp; a flat or lower FY2026 print is the mechanism stalling.

Everything in this memo resolves against that one filing, roughly four weeks from the as-of date. That is an unusually clean catalyst structure for a long.
